Output 51d20c8d635e14270ea95c74f25c5e0671029e4ef1b4d3de402ad327e7efee6f:1

value
29609
script pubkey
OP_0 OP_PUSHBYTES_20 2942f9fc307db89d465f688ba4646d681d16425c
address
bc1q99p0nlps0kuf63jldz96gerddqw3vsju4m8rvz
transaction
51d20c8d635e14270ea95c74f25c5e0671029e4ef1b4d3de402ad327e7efee6f
confirmations
321605
spent
true